#wrap-Side,
#wrap-contents{
	margin:                     15px 0 0 0;
}


/* Contents */



#wrap-contents h2{
	background:                 url(../img/ttl.jpg) no-repeat;
	height:                     80px;
	text-indent:                -9999px;
	font-size:                  2px;
	margin:
}


#category01{
	font-size:                  12px;
	line-height:                20px;
	margin:                     30px 30px 0 30px;
}

#category01 p{
	background:                 url(../img/hosho_img.jpg) no-repeat;
	padding:                    230px 0 0 0;
	margin:                     20px 0 0 0;
}



#category02{
	background:                 url(../img/subttl_01.jpg) no-repeat;
	margin:                     30px 0 30px 0;
	padding:                    0 240px 0 0;
	font-size:                  12px;
	line-height:                20px;
	padding:                    45px 0 0 0;
}

#category02 p{
	line-height:                20px;
	font-size:                  12px;
	margin-left:                30px;
}


#category03{
	background:                 url(../img/subttl_02.jpg) no-repeat;
	font-size:                  12px;
	line-height:                20px;
	padding:                    55px 0 0 0;
}

#category03 p{
	background:                 url(../img/case.gif) no-repeat top;
	height:                     194px;
	width:                      610;
	text-indent:                -9999px;
	font-size:                  2px;
}





